1. 电厂直流屏监测系统概述
在电力系统中,直流屏相当于整个控制回路的"心脏",它为继电保护、自动装置、信号系统等关键设备提供稳定可靠的直流电源。一旦直流系统出现故障,可能导致保护拒动或误动,造成大面积停电事故。因此,实时监测直流屏的运行状态至关重要。
我们采用西门子S7-1200 PLC和WinCC组态软件搭建的这套监测系统,能够实现对直流屏母线电压、蓄电池电流、绝缘状态等关键参数的24小时不间断监控。系统具备以下核心功能:
- 实时采集模拟量(电压、电流)和开关量(断路器状态、熔断器报警)
- 越限报警与事件记录
- 历史数据存储与趋势分析
- 可视化人机界面
提示:直流屏监测系统的设计必须符合DL/T 5044-2014《电力工程直流电源系统设计技术规程》的要求,特别是报警阈值设置需要参考该标准。
2. 硬件系统设计与配置
2.1 硬件选型与拓扑结构
系统硬件架构采用典型的"传感器+PLC+HMI"三层结构:
- 传感层:电压变送器、霍尔电流传感器、断路器辅助触点等
- 控制层:西门子S7-1214C DC/DC/DC PLC(含数字量输入、模拟量输入、继电器输出模块)
- 监控层:工控机安装WinCC V7.5组态软件
特别说明选型考虑:
- 选用SM1231模拟量输入模块(8AI)因其支持0-10V电压输入,与变送器输出匹配
- 继电器输出模块选择SM1222(8DO)满足报警指示灯和蜂鸣器控制需求
- 所有DI通道均配置光耦隔离,防止现场干扰
2.2 详细接线方案
2.2.1 模拟量输入接线
电压变送器(0-100V DC → 0-5V DC)接线要点:
- 变送器电源取自直流屏控制母线(+KM/-KM)
- 输出信号线采用双绞屏蔽线(型号RVVP 2×0.75)
- 屏蔽层单端接地(PLC侧接地)
- 信号正极接AI+,负极接AI-和MANA
霍尔电流传感器接线注意事项:
- 电源电压必须稳定(建议增加DC-DC稳压模块)
- 穿孔方向必须与实际电流方向一致
- 空置的电流输入端需短接,避免开路高压
2.2.2 数字量输入接线
断路器状态监测采用无源干接点输入:
- 每个DI通道并联RC吸收回路(100Ω+0.1μF)
- 长距离电缆(>50m)需在PLC侧增加终端电阻
- 熔断器报警接点需串接1kΩ限流电阻
2.3 IO分配表优化设计
在原始IO分配基础上,我们进行了功能扩展和优化:
| 地址 | 信号类型 | 功能描述 | 量程/状态说明 |
|---|---|---|---|
| I0.0 | DI | 主路断路器合位 | 1=合位,0=分位 |
| I0.1 | DI | 馈线熔断器报警 | 1=报警,0=正常 |
| I0.2 | DI | 绝缘监测装置报警 | 新增功能点 |
| IW64 | AI | 母线电压 | 0-5V对应0-100V DC |
| IW66 | AI | 电池电流 | ±5V对应±100A |
| Q0.0 | DO | 过压声光报警 | 脉冲触发(3s) |
| Q0.1 | DO | 欠压报警 | 新增输出点 |
| Q0.2 | DO | 馈线故障指示灯 | 保持输出 |
3. PLC程序设计详解
3.1 报警逻辑实现技巧
3.1.1 带回差的电压比较
在TIA Portal中实现回差控制的梯形图程序:
ladder复制// 网络1:过压检测
L "母线电压"
L 55.0
>=R
S "过压标志"
// 网络2:过压恢复检测
L "母线电压"
L 54.8
<=R
R "过压标志"
关键点说明:
- 使用浮点数比较指令(>=R/<=R)确保精度
- 回差幅度(0.2V)根据现场波动情况可调
- 报警标志需使用掉电保持型存储区(MB100-MB127)
3.1.2 电池轮询检测算法
采用循环扫描方式检测多节电池电压:
scala复制// 在OB1中实现
IF "1秒脉冲" THEN
"当前电池号" := "当前电池号" + 1;
IF "当前电池号" > 18 THEN
"当前电池号" := 1;
END_IF;
CASE "当前电池号" OF
1: "电池电压" := "电池1电压";
2: "电池电压" := "电池2电压";
// ...其他电池
END_CASE;
END_IF;
3.2 通信故障处理机制
针对Modbus TCP通信不稳定问题,设计三重保障:
- 心跳检测:每5秒发送诊断请求,连续3次超时触发重连
- 数据校验:添加CRC校验和超时判断
- 缓存机制:通信中断时使用最近有效值,并触发预警
ladder复制// 网络10:通信状态监测
L "上次通信时间"
L "当前时间"
-D
L 15000 // 15秒超时
>D
= "通信故障"
// 网络11:自动重连控制
L "通信故障"
FP "边沿标志"
CALL "MB_CLIENT_DB"
4. WinCC组态设计要点
4.1 人机界面设计规范
主监控界面采用分层设计:
- 状态区:顶部显示系统时间、通信状态、报警摘要
- 主显示区:中央为蓄电池组模拟图,采用颜色编码:
- 绿色:12.0V-13.5V(正常)
- 黄色:11.8V-12.0V或13.5V-13.8V(预警)
- 红色:<11.8V或>13.8V(故障)
- 操作区:底部放置报警确认、消音等按钮
注意:颜色编码需符合电力行业惯例,红色仅用于需要立即干预的严重故障
4.2 历史数据配置技巧
-
归档设置:
- 模拟量:5秒采样周期,压缩存储(变化量>1%才记录)
- 开关量:状态变化时记录
- 报警信息:带时间戳和确认状态
-
趋势图优化:
- 采用"先入先出"显示模式,时间轴自动滚动
- 曲线宽度设为2像素,不同变量用对比色
- 添加参考线(如浮充电压53.5V)
-
报表生成:
- 每日自动生成运行日报(PDF格式)
- 包含极值统计、报警次数汇总等
5. 系统调试与故障排查
5.1 常见问题处理手册
| 故障现象 | 可能原因 | 排查方法 | 解决方案 |
|---|---|---|---|
| 模拟量数值跳变 | 信号干扰 | 用万用表测量传感器输出 | 加磁环/更换屏蔽线 |
| 通信间歇性中断 | 网络拥塞 | ping测试网络延迟 | 调整交换机QoS设置 |
| 报警不触发 | 变量连接错误 | 检查WinCC变量类型 | 重新建立变量连接 |
| 历史数据丢失 | 归档空间不足 | 检查硬盘剩余空间 | 扩展归档周期或增加存储 |
| 画面响应慢 | 脚本执行耗时过长 | 使用WinCC性能分析工具 | 优化脚本,减少全局变量访问 |
5.2 现场调试经验
-
抗干扰措施:
- 所有模拟量信号线远离动力电缆(间距>30cm)
- 在PLC电源进线端加装电源滤波器
- 机柜接地电阻应<4Ω
-
参数优化:
- 模拟量滤波时间常数根据信号特性调整(典型值50-100ms)
- 报警延时设置(一般1-3秒)避免误报
- 修改PLC扫描周期(默认10ms)平衡响应速度和CPU负载
-
维护建议:
- 每月备份项目文件(包括PLC程序和HMI画面)
- 每季度检查传感器校准状态
- 每年进行系统全功能测试
这套系统在某330kV变电站实际运行两年多来,成功预警了3次蓄电池组异常和1次母线绝缘下降故障,验证了其可靠性和实用性。特别是在一次直流接地故障中,系统在30秒内准确定位到故障支路,为快速恢复供电赢得了宝贵时间。